Key Facts
- Vote-by-mail ballot requests made through this system are valid through the end of 2026.
- Voters can track their mail ballot status, including when it is sent, received, and counted.
- The county provides a 2026 Voter Guide for additional election information.
- Resources are available for voters to 'cure' (fix) issues with their mail or absentee ballots.
- The site provides information on voter rights, identification requirements, and how to mark a ballot.
